Key Considerations for Ventilating Small Structures

Ventilating small structures is essential for ensuring good air quality, maintaining comfortable temperatures, and preventing structural damage. While the need for ventilation is often overlooked, it plays a crucial role in sustainability and the longevity of buildings. This blog post will explore key considerations for properly ventilating small spaces and offer actionable recommendations.


Understanding Ventilation Solutions


Ventilation is the process of exchanging air in a given space to improve indoor air quality. For small structures, effective ventilation solutions can help remove excess moisture, unpleasant odors, and harmful pollutants. There are two primary types of ventilation: passive and active. Passive ventilation relies on natural airflow, while active ventilation uses mechanical systems to facilitate air exchange.


In small spaces, where air stagnation can occur easily, both types of ventilation are important. Natural ventilation can be achieved through windows, vents, and openings, but in cases where natural airflow is insufficient, mechanical systems may be necessary.




Factors to Consider for Ventilation


When planning ventilation for small structures, consider the following factors:


1. Size of the Structure


The size and layout of the structure significantly affect ventilation needs. In general, more compact spaces require less air exchange than larger ones. However, if a small structure has a high occupancy rate—for example, a workshop or hobby space—the demand for fresh air increases. It is recommended to calculate the required ventilation rate based on the size of the building and its intended use.


2. Purpose of the Structure


Different activities generate varying amounts of pollutants and moisture. For example, a garden shed might not need extensive ventilation, while a workshop with adhesives and paints requires robust airflow. Understanding the purpose of the small structure will assist in determining the appropriate ventilation strategies.


Customized ventilation strategies could involve using an appropriate number of air changes per hour (ACH). For residential structures, an ACH of 0.35 to 1.0 is often recommended, whereas areas with high moisture or pollutants may need higher rates.




3. What is the Best Way to Air Condition a Shed?


Air conditioning a shed effectively requires a combination of ventilation and cooling strategies. Initially, ensure that all possible ventilation outlets—like windows or vents—are utilized to prevent heat build-up. For more powerful cooling, consider obtaining a portable air conditioning unit or ductless mini-split system tailored for smaller spaces.


Additionally, incorporating fans can significantly enhance airflow. Fans can help distribute cool air evenly, making the environment more comfortable. For maximum effectiveness, position fans to create cross-ventilation.


4. Climate and Weather Conditions


The local climate plays a crucial role in selecting an appropriate ventilation approach. In hot and humid climates, ventilation helps control moisture and promotes evaporation. In contrast, dry or colder climates might prioritize thermal insulation instead of maximum airflow.


For example, in cooler climates, consider combining ventilation with insulation, using a shed ventilation system that exhausts warm air during the hotter parts of the day while retaining heat during colder ones.


5. Budget and Cost


When assessing ventilation solutions, it is crucial to consider the budget. Passive systems, such as vents and windows, are generally less expensive than active systems, which require electrical installations and ongoing costs. It is vital to evaluate the long-term benefits and possibly prioritize initial investments in a high-quality ventilation system over cheaper alternatives.


Maintenance of Ventilation Systems


Once a ventilation system has been installed, regular maintenance is key to ensuring its effectiveness. Here are a few maintenance tips:


  • Inspect filters regularly: If the system has filters, replace or clean them according to the manufacturer's recommendations.

  • Check for blockages: Ensure vents and ducts are clear of debris or blockages, which can impede airflow.

  • Monitor humidity levels: Using a hygrometer can help assess if your ventilation system is effectively controlling humidity. Ideal humidity levels typically range from 30% to 50%.
